External beam radiation for HCC: Ready for incorporation into guidelines?

Michael Buckstein1, Laura A Dawson2

  • 1Department of Radiation Oncology, Icahn School of Medicine at Mount Sinai, New York, NY, USA.

Summary

External beam radiation therapy shows excellent results for managing hepatocellular carcinoma across all stages. Incorporating this effective, low-cost treatment into guidelines can significantly improve patient outcomes globally.

Biological Effects of Radiation

All radioactive nuclides emit high-energy particles or electromagnetic waves. When this radiation encounters living cells, it can cause heating, break chemical bonds, or ionize molecules. The most serious biological damage results when these radioactive emissions fragment or ionize molecules.
